#113d7e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#113d7e is composed of 6.7% red, 23.9%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.5% cyan, 51.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 215.8 degrees, a saturation of 76.2% and a lightness of 28%. #113d7e color hex could be obtained by blending #227afc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

#113d7e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#113d7e has RGB values of R:17, G:61, B:126 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0.52, Y:0,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 1129854.

Shades and Tints of #113d7e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010205 is the darkest color, while #f3f7f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#113d7e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#43474d is the less saturated color, while #003a8f is the most saturated one.
